Does Virginia Beach Connect To Outer Banks?

The Pungo area of Virginia Beach connects to Knotts Island (which is actually a peninsula) in North Carolina. There is a free ferry from Knotts Island to the Currituck County NC mainland, then you can drive on to OBX.

Can you drive on the beach from Virginia Beach to Corolla NC?

There is no direct connection from Virginia Beach to Corolla. However, you can take the drive to Knotts Island, NC, take the car ferry to Currituck, NC, then take the drive to Corolla.

Do you have to take a ferry to OBX?

No. You only need to worry about riding a ferry if you are going to Ocracoke. You will have an easy drive in on 40 and 64. You will go over a few bridges and be on the Outer Banks.

What beach in Outer Banks Can you drive on?

The most popular destinations for year-round beach driving is the 4WD accessible beaches north of Corolla, Hatteras Island, and Ocracoke Island. Wintertime beach driving is also allowed in central Outer Banks communities including Nags Head and Kill Devil Hills.

Do you have to pay to drive on Corolla beach?

Currituck County requires 4×4 parking permits to park on the beach beginning the last Saturday in April to the first Saturday in October. You do not need a pass to drive on the beach or park at the home. Two 4×4 parking passes are included with each 4×4 vacation home.

Does Virginia Beach border North Carolina?

The city extends 28 miles (45 km) southward from the mouth of Chesapeake Bay to the North Carolina border, covering 302 square miles (782 square km) of land and water, with 28 miles (45 km) of ocean front.

Where do the Outer Banks start and end?

North Carolina’s Outer Banks are a string of barrier islands that begin at the Virginia border and go south for 120 miles to Ocracoke Island. Tourism is the number one industry of the Outer Banks with more than 5 million visitors each year.

Can you drive to see wild horses in Outer Banks?

The Corolla Wild Horses can be found on the northern beaches of Corolla and Carova. This area is only accessible by four wheel drive vehicles because you must drive on the beach itself.

Where is the best place to see wild horses on the Outer Banks?

The wild horses live primarily in the northern portion of the Outer Banks, which includes Corolla and Carova Beach. The horses roam the northern portion of Currituck Beach, which is a rural area with little development.
